The Moon's ethereal glow mingles with the King of Swords' sharp intellect, creating a dance between intuition and logic in your emotional realm. Your heart may be navigating through uncertain waters where feelings shift like tides, yet the King's clarity offers a beacon of rational understanding. This combination suggests that your romantic path requires both emotional sensitivity and mental discernment to navigate successfully. The shadows of past wounds or illusions may surface, but the King's wisdom provides the tools to cut through confusion with compassionate truth. Trust both your intuitive knowing and your ability to communicate with clarity and kindness.
In your professional sphere, The Moon illuminates hidden aspects of your work environment while the King of Swords brings strategic thinking to murky situations. You may find yourself in a position where appearances deceive and undercurrents run deeper than what meets the eye. The King's analytical nature can help you pierce through workplace illusions and see situations for what they truly are. Your challenge lies in balancing intuitive insights with logical decision-making, allowing both your inner wisdom and intellectual prowess to guide your choices. This is a time for careful observation and thoughtful communication rather than hasty judgments.
The Moon's mystical energy calls you into the depths of your unconscious while the King of Swords offers the discernment to understand what you discover there. Your spiritual journey may feel like walking through a dreamscape where symbols and signs require careful interpretation. The King's presence suggests that your path to enlightenment involves not just feeling and experiencing, but also analyzing and integrating your spiritual insights. You're being invited to become a wise observer of your own inner landscape, neither dismissing mystical experiences nor accepting them without question. This combination encourages you to develop both psychic sensitivity and spiritual discernment.
You stand at a threshold where mystery and clarity converge, each offering valuable gifts for your journey of self-discovery. The shadows that The Moon reveals are not meant to frighten you, but to show you aspects of yourself that need acknowledgment and integration. Allow the King of Swords' wisdom to help you approach these revelations with both compassion and objectivity, neither judging harshly nor ignoring important truths. Consider how your emotional intelligence and rational mind can work as allies rather than adversaries in your personal growth. This is a moment to embrace both the questions that stir your soul and the answers that emerge through patient reflection.
